FS: '81 240D Auto, New Jersey


I'm selling my trusty 240D. I bought back in May after I lost my car in an accident. The car is kind of a monster. It was originally a 300D and had a 240D engine transplanted. With the little money I had this was my best option and I wanted something I could work on (if time allowed). I'm selling it now because I need the money and I can't afford insurance on an extra car right now. I hate to see it go but I'd rather sell it to someone that understands these cars.

Since May I have replaced the alternator and alternator bracket, glow plugs, and performed a diesel purge. The car starts right up after using the glow plugs, and takes about 7 seconds to start on a cold engine without the use of the gp's.

The car has never failed me or left me on the side of the road, although it does need some minor attention. Here's the list:

-Tranny's shifting hard. I've been troubleshooting the vac system little by little and replaced many components in the engine bay. Additionally, the linkage to the transmission needs adjustment, since the reverse lights only go one when pushing the shifter down towards neutral.

-Some of the injectors are leaking. The leaks are were the injectors meet the block. I cleaned the block to see how much they leaked and its not severe.

-There is (I believe) a mileage discrepancy. I made the mistake of not asking the previous owner if the odo is the original one or the one belonging to the new motor. It definitely has been messed around with because there are scratches inside the cluster and trip ODO doesnt work.

-There's some rust on the body and the paint is not original. The paint job is a little poor on some parts of the car. One of the jackholes got covered up. I assuming it was pretty bad.

There are other things the car needs. I was planning on keeping the car as a daily driver since it never had reliability issues. I drove it 6 miles to and from work everyday and loved it.
